If you are pulling the whole unit then I assume the yellow line is not longer the issue. It just will not come out? If the car is high miles you can get a lot of built up of clutch dust on the input shaft on the "other" side of the clutch plate. This can make remove very tuff.

If this the case it should not get like a hard stop, it should feel almost like a spring is holding it. You have two joices Unbolt the clutch or go Gorilla on it. Also make sure you are pulling straight out, the clutch plate does not like to bind.
